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: I have repeatedly had the serpentine belt come off while driving in my 1999 dodge grand caravan. this is unsafe. i lose power steering, a/c or defroster, the van overheats unless you park it instantly. this has happened at least a dozen times and i have replaced the tension pulley and it still didn't help. this needs to be recalled. *jb
